Behold the 2025 Range Rover Sport autobiography with PHEV, a luxurious beast priced at a staggering $118,000 base, soaring to $128,000 when fully optioned. It stands as the second-highest trim in the lineup, taking on the Porsche Cayenne in a battle of opulence and power. This autobiography offers a choice between an inline 6 engine or a BMW V8, with an even more premium SV trim costing nearly $180,000, boasting the x5m competition drivetrain. However, despite its grandeur, these Range Rovers face a harsh reality - steep depreciation rates, shedding over 40% of their value in the first three years and over 50% in five years.

Interior comfort reigns supreme in the autobiography, pampering passengers with lavish features while sacrificing some cargo space. The front and rear seats offer unparalleled comfort, with the finest leather exuding luxury. Yet, a disappointing contrast emerges in the switchgear department, where the piano black finish feels disappointingly cheap for a vehicle of this caliber. However, the headliner's suede touch and the car's hushed noise floor provide a sense of tranquility within the cabin. On the tech front, the infotainment system embraces minimalism by ditching physical controls, while the 800W Meridian Audio System elevates the auditory experience.

Beneath its luxurious facade lies the robust MLA Flex architecture, housing a plethora of electromechanical systems and modules that enhance safety and performance. Equipped with adaptive dampers, rear steer, torque vectoring, and a rear differential, this Range Rover is primed for both on-road elegance and off-road prowess. The autobiography's driving character leans more towards a land yacht than a sports sedan, offering a surprisingly nimble feel despite its boat-like nature. The ingenium I6 with PHEV setup delivers a potent yet refined performance, rivaling that of a V8 engine. In essence, the autobiography embodies a blend of luxury, power, and off-road capability, albeit with a few quirks that may irk the discerning driver.
